Greenwood Village Cafe is a locally owned cafe in Greenwood Village, CO, known for serving premium locally roasted coffee from Kaladi Coffee Roasters and offering the finest baked goods in the Denver Tech Center.
With a focus on fresh food and great service, Greenwood Village Cafe also provides breakfast and lunch catering services.
Generated from the website